Injection molding device for producing a terminal cover plate for a vacuum cleaner

By utilizing the injection molding mechanism and adjustment mechanism of the injection molding device, along with a gear and rack structure and an electric telescopic rod, rapid and automated demolding of the vacuum cleaner terminal cover plate is achieved, solving the problem of low demolding efficiency in existing technologies and improving production efficiency.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of vacuum cleaner terminal cover plates, specifically to an injection molding device for producing vacuum cleaner terminal cover plates. Background Technology

[0002] Vacuum cleaners can be classified into upright, canister, and portable types according to their structure. The working principle of a vacuum cleaner is that an electric motor drives the blades to rotate at high speed, creating negative air pressure inside the sealed housing to suck up dust and debris. However, the production of vacuum cleaner terminal cover plates requires the use of injection molding equipment.

[0003] Existing injection molding equipment typically combines the upper and lower molds for injection molding. However, in actual use, it is not easy to quickly and conveniently demold the mold after injection molding, requiring operators to manually demold, which can easily damage the mold and reduce the working efficiency of the injection molding equipment.

[0025] Please see Figures 1-5 This utility model provides a technical solution: Example

[0026] An injection molding apparatus for producing terminal cover plates for vacuum cleaners includes a base plate 1 and a support leg 2, with an injection molding structure disposed on the top of the base plate 1;

[0027] The injection molding structure includes an injection molding mechanism 3 and an adjustment mechanism 4;

[0028] The injection molding mechanism 3 includes a lower mold 301, a guide rod 302, an adjusting plate 303, a rack 304, and a gear 305. The inner wall of the lower mold 301 is connected to both ends of the guide rod 302. The outer wall of the guide rod 302 is slidably connected to the inner wall of the adjusting plate 303. The bottom of the adjusting plate 303 is connected to the top of the rack 304. One side of the rack 304 meshes with one side of the gear 305. A rotating rod 306 is fixedly installed on the inner wall of the gear 305. A rack 307 meshes with one side of the gear 305. A connecting plate 308 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the rack 307. A support plate 309 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the connecting plate 308. An extrusion plate 310 is fixedly installed at the top of the support plate 309. A demolding plate 311 is fixedly installed at the top of the extrusion plate 310.

[0029] In this embodiment, a movable groove is provided on one side of the lower mold 301, and there are four guide rods 302. The guide rods 302 are symmetrically distributed on the inner wall of the lower mold 301. One end of the adjusting plate 303 is slidably connected to the inner wall of the movable groove, so that the position of the adjusting plate 303 can be adjusted quickly and conveniently, thereby enabling better injection molding.

[0030] Furthermore, a spring is fixedly installed between the bottom of the adjusting plate 303 and the inner wall of the lower mold 301. There are two gears 305, which are symmetrically distributed on the outer wall of the rotating rod 306, so that the position of the rack 407 can be adjusted quickly and conveniently, thereby enabling better demolding.

[0031] Furthermore, there are two racks 307, which are symmetrically distributed on the inner wall of the lower mold 301. There are also two extrusion plates 310, which are symmetrically distributed at the bottom of the demolding template 311. This allows for quick and convenient adjustment of the position of the demolding template 311, thus enabling better demolding.

[0032] When injection molding is required, the operator can quickly and easily fit the upper mold 406 and the lower mold 301 by activating the adjustment mechanism 4, thus enabling quick and convenient injection molding. When demolding is required after injection molding, the operator pulls the adjustment plate 303 to slide it on the guide rod 302. The sliding adjustment plate 303 compresses the spring and drives the rack 1 304 to move. The movement of rack 1 304 drives the gear 305 to rotate. The rotation of gear 305 drives the rack 2 307 to move. The movement of the 7th adjustment plate 308 causes the connecting plate 308 to move, which in turn causes the support plate 309 to move, which in turn causes the extrusion plate 310 to move, which in turn causes the demolding plate 311 to move. The movement of the demolding plate 311 allows the mold to be quickly and easily pushed out of the lower mold 301, thus enabling better demolding and better use. After demolding is completed, the adjusting plate 303 is released and reset by the spring force, thereby improving the working efficiency of the injection molding device. Example

[0033] Based on Embodiment 1, the adjustment mechanism 4 includes a support rod 401, a bearing plate 402, an electric telescopic rod 403, a mounting plate 404, and a telescopic rod 405. The outer wall of the support rod 401 is connected to the inner wall of the bearing plate 402. The inner wall of the bearing plate 402 is connected to the outer wall of the electric telescopic rod 403. The bottom of the electric telescopic rod 403 is connected to the top of the mounting plate 404. The top of the mounting plate 404 is connected to the bottom of the telescopic rod 405. An upper mold 406 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the mounting plate 404. A positioning rod 407 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the mounting plate 404.

[0034] In this embodiment, there are four support rods 401, which are symmetrically distributed at the bottom of the bearing plate 402. There are also four positioning rods 407, which are symmetrically distributed at the bottom of the mounting plate 404. This allows for quick and convenient adjustment of the position of the upper mold 406, thereby enabling better injection molding.

[0035] Furthermore, the bottom of the base plate 1 is connected to the top of the support leg 2, the top of the base plate 1 is connected to the bottom of the lower mold 301, and the top of the base plate 1 is connected to the bottom of the support rod 401.

[0036] When injection molding is required, the operator activates the electric telescopic rod 403 to move the mounting plate 404. The movement of the mounting plate 404 causes the telescopic rod 405 to extend and retract, thereby increasing the stability of the mounting plate 404 during movement. The movement of the mounting plate 404 also moves the upper mold 406, allowing for quick and convenient adjustment of the position of the upper mold 406. This ensures that the upper mold 406 fits snugly against the lower mold 301 for better injection molding. The mounting positioning rod 407 further ensures proper positioning and prevents misalignment. After injection molding is complete, the mold can be quickly and easily demolded using the injection molding mechanism 3, making it more convenient for operators to use.
